I am going to try out my first GL Pease blend, and by the sounds of it Westminster and Quiet Nights are both something i would enjoy. What is the difference between the two, and which one would you recommend I try first?

Both are good.
Quiet Nights is a flake and has a bit of a gasoline smell. Oddly it works though, very good.
Westminster is a ribbon cut, full english, oriental forward.
I would recommend Westminster as your first GLP english blend. I think it's a bit more approachable than Quiet Nights is. I also think, although both are great, Westminster is more of 'an all day' smoke. Quiet Nights is more of a bowl here-and-there smoke.

Westminster has a bit more Latakia “punch” in my opinion. I really like orientals, and prefer Westminster and Cairo to Quiet Nights. But you can’t really go very wrong with Pease, so start sampling!

I enjoy Westminster but it is rather Lat-strong and the orientals are very buttery. I enjoy Chelsea Morning from G.L. Pease. Its a good all day blend with enough Latakia to suffice the craving. Its also very good paired with black coffee, as it mentions on the tin label.
